您正在查看 "Web" 分类下的文章
2007/11/01 17:22
dwr是开源项目,拿到其源代码后还是很想了解它是如何实现这种js到java的调用。花了一个下午的时间从页面的js调用开始一步步跟踪,有了个基本的认识。给出下面一个示例,然后一步步说明先后的调用关系。
这里有一个类
package cn.iscas.dwr.test;
class HelloDWR{
public String hello(String name)
{
return "hello:\t"+name;
}
}
在dwr.xml文件中添加HelloDWR的声明:
<?xml version="1.0" encoding= |
2007/10/31 09:40
Cookies,有些人喜欢它们,有些人憎恨它们。
什么是Cookies?
你会问,什么是cookies呢? cookie 是浏览器保存在用户计算机上的少量数据。它与特定的WEB页或WEB站点关联起来,自动地在WEB浏览器和WEB服务器之间传递。
比如,如果你运行的是Windows操作系统,使用Internet Explorer上网,那么你会发现在你的“Windows”目录下面有一个子目录,叫做“Temporary Internet Files”。如果你有空看看这个目录,就会发现里面有一些文件,文件名称看起来就象电子邮件地址。比 |
2007/10/26 16:11
在工程中使用DWR
DWR的使用简单,稍有java的web应用开发基础的人参照dwr的在线文档都应该没有什么问题。下面两个步骤,就可以利用js来访问自己的写的Java对象的方法了。
1.将dwr的servlet加入到web应用的web.xml中,
<servlet>
<servlet-name>dwr-invoker</servlet- |
2007/10/26 00:04
最近的一部分开发中,希望能引入AJAX,这样使以争强界面访问的友好性。在open-open的AJAX开发组件中看到了DWR,于是花了几天时间来学习学习。
DWR,Direct Web Remoting)是一个WEB远程调用框架,利用这个框架可以让AJAX开发变得很简单。利用DWR可以在客户端利用JavaScript直接调用服务 端的Java方法并返回值给JavaScript就好像直接本地客户端调用一样(DWR根据Java类来动态生成JavaScrip代码)。
|
|
|